Transaction 75f6dabd4d659b91b7aa528a4107ee0fc79ab9c47de3cbb51530c641c5d5c5d6
1 Input
1 Output
-
75f6dabd4d659b91b7aa528a4107ee0fc79ab9c47de3cbb51530c641c5d5c5d6:0
- value
- 543194
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53c9dec8b142f8161694cbfe33ee19f7eebbc45b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18e2v7YPP74mvCzjvt6FhKLugcYn9VjR9U